Common 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e Errors on Windows

Encountering errors associated with 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e can be frustrating. These errors may vary in nature and can surface due to different reasons, such as software conflicts, outdated drivers, or even malware infections. Below, we've outlined the most commonly reported errors linked to 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e, to aid in understanding and potentially resolving the issues at hand.

  • 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e File Not Executing: This alert shows up when the system cannot initiate the executable file. Possible causes could include file corruption, inappropriate file permissions, or a lack of necessary system resources.
  • Error 0xc0000142: This error is often encountered when a user tries to initialize a Microsoft Windows application and the system fails to initialize 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e correctly.
  •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This error message is displayed when the application is not able to launch properly, usually due to a mix-up between 32-bit and 64-bit versions of Windows and the application.
  • ${EXCUTABLE_NAME}.exe has Stopped Working: This warning is displayed when the system detects that the executable file is no longer performing as expected. This can be caused by software errors, interference from other applications, or system resource limitations.
  •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error message signifies that the program is incompatible with the Windows version in use, or the program file could be damaged.

Step 1: Open Command Prompt

Step 1: Open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run DISM Scan

Step 2: Run DISM Scan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th and press Enter.

  2.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.
